Riahc was still motionless laying in his bed and Aniram was growing impatient. “Move or you will be moved!” That got him up. He was still moving slowly, as if completely dazed, but at least he was on his feet. Aniram continued to busily pack essential items of Riahc’s because she was certain he would forget them. A small knife, some string, canvas, flint and steel, a blanket, a change of clothes (ordinary), and some hard bread, smoked meat and flakey cheese all went into Riahc’s saddle bags. Aniram’s bags contained similar items with the addition of a tiny hummingbird figurine, a special cloak, and her Aes Sedai shall (she never went anywhere without it).

When Aniram was sure she had not forgotten anything she grabbed Riahc by the wrist as he continued to struggle with the laces of his boots, and dragged him to the west stables. There two ordinary looking brown horsed stood, fully saddled and waiting. She had purchased the horses last night for a decent price. She had thought of everything. Aniram dropped Riahc’s wrist and briskly entered and clambered up onto her horse, still largely unaccustomed to the animals. She was about to call to Riahc to help her get her horse moving but she noticed that he hadn’t moved since she let go of him. His large form completely barricaded the open doorway; his feet were firmly planted on the dusty ground. He had an ‘explain or try to nock me down’ look on his face. “Stubborn, uncomprehending men!” Aniram muttered darkly under her breath. She shot him a look that would have moved a lesser man, but Riahc didn’t even flinch. Aniram sighed; she would have to explain, not all, but enough to get the oaf to accompany her. “What do you remember from last night?”

“I killed a darkfriend, and then introduced myself,” Riahc stated plainly.

“And then…”

“And then you woke me up today.”

“You remember nothing else?” Aniram had to make sure, so that she could play this out right.

“Nothing past giving you my name.”

“Then I shall inform you of the later events. I gave you my name, Aniram Sedai, just as a horde of darkfriends tried to kill me. You killed them all but lost an excessive amount of blood.” Aniram stopped, annoyed because Riahc was checking his body for new scars. “You were healed!” she snapped, then continued on in a calmer tone, “Just before you passed out you promised to protect me at all times. Then you were moved to your room, and well, you know the rest. So, now that you have heard, will you go back on your word?” Aniram was quite impressed with her little speech. Now, all she needed was the right answer.

“If I gave my word, I will stay true. I am your man.” Riahc gave the right answer.

“Good, then get on your animal and let us ride.”

They rode out of Tar Valon with little difficulty in the direction of the village of Four Kings. They rode in silence. When Aniram could no longer make out the city on the horizon behind her, although the White Tower itself was still visible, she decided that the time was right. They were too far away to turn back. Out of her saddlebags Aniram pulled out a cloak. It shifted colours, from green to blue to grey then back to green, in the short time that it took to thrust it in the direction of Riahc. “You’d better put this on.”

When he saw what she was offering he barely missed a beat. “I’m not a full warder yet. I cannot wear the cloak unless an Aes Sedai bonds me.” The truth of the situation finally hit home. Riahc was speechless.

“You Riahc are Warder of Aniram Aes Sedai of the Green Ajah. You are mine.” With this Aniram untied the weave that prevented Riahc from knowing her own emotions. Riahc stopped cold.

Riahc sat his chestnut gelding calmly as he and the Aes Sedai called Aniram cantered easily due south. Every few minutes he glanced anxiously at the small woman bouncing atop the bay she had chosen for herself. He didn't want to offer any advice, as to not offend the Aes Sedai, but he couldn't help feel nervous watching her. Riahc himself had always enjoyed riding and was always amazing when other people did not. Slowing to a halt far enough away from Tar Valon that only the gleaming White Tower sparked in the sun, Aniram pulled from her saddlebags a green cloak that switched to brown, to grey, and then back to green, and spoke the first words since leaving Tar Valon. "You'd better put this on," she suggested calmly. Riahc realized what was being asked of him, and he was startled.

"I’m not a full warder yet. I cannot wear the cloak unless an Aes Sedai bonds me.” Riahc eyes widened as the two things clicked in his mind. A flaming Aes Sedai is asking me to wear a bloody Warder's cloak. Light! She wants me to be her - Riach stopped in thought as he felt something invisible tighten around his body and suddenly he had this strange new awareness of Aniram. He could feel her emotions, he could feel her hurts (she bottom end was definately sore) and he could feel her tiredness from the long ride.

"... Warder ... Aes Sedai ... Green Ajah ... Mine" were the only words Riahc heard. He was too overwhelmed to think. Riahc promtly fell off the side of his horse, which he had named Bobby, after the way his head bobbed up and down while cantering. Opening his eyes, Riahc found himself looking into the face of Bobby who had been sniffing him curiously. Riahc groaned and rose to his feet to see Aniram trying to dismount her bay mare with difficulty.

Aniram was muttering angrily about how her own two feet were always good enough to her, how her mare was a wild beast and things of the like. Riahc walked slowly up to where the bay mare danced nervously, picking up on her riders emotion. Frustration flooded through the bond. Yes, this bond thing would definitely take some adapting to. Riahc placed his hands on Aniram's sides and gently lifted her from her horse. Again Riahc felt her emotion through the bond, this time, startlement tinged with anger. As Aniram turned around her mouth opened to say something, but her mouth closed at the same time the startlement and anger was pushed down. Aniram looked at Riahc with that weighing gaze, that would take some adapting to aswell, and finally said, "Are you all right?"

"Are you inquiring about the fall, or the bond?" Riahc replied calmly.

"Both."

"Well, I must admit, this will take some adjusting to, but it's not anything I'm not willing to face. As for the fall, other then a bruise on my shoulder, I reckon I'll be fine. But then, you could probably have told me that." Riahc said with a smile.

"Yes, I suppose I could have done that indeed. But now we are just wasting sunlight, and I mean to be in Four Kings by dark." Aniram said regaining her bossiness.

"Blood and ashes, Four Kings? Why would we go there?" Riahc asked. Four Kings? Light, I haven't been in Four Kings for years. When I left there I had no intention of ever returning. Blood and bloody ashes! "Listen, some things happened to me in flaming Four Kings. Things I'd rather not be reminded of, if that's quite all right with you." Riahc said, feeling the memories flood back into his mind as his brows began to fall into a face that would startle anyone but an Aes Sedai. Riahc had always had a bad mouth. His mother slap his bottom with a spoon when he would curse, but since arriving at Tar Valon, he rarely let his mouth run.

"First of all," Aniram said, "you will learn to control that tounge of yours and speak like a man, not some child trying to be a man. And second of all, I'm aware you were born in Four Kings, and that is exactly why we must go there first. If we are ever to find who that darkfriend was we must start at the beginning."

Riahc had to turn away. He would not, could not, let this Aes Sedai see him weaken. He remembered his mother's warm smile, his father's strong arms carrying him as they picked fruit from the trees, and his young sister's voice as she sang sweetly with the birds outside. Riahc felt tears try to fall from his eyes, but he pushed them away, instead, he schooled his face to calm with more effort than the hardest drill the Warders in training had to do. Buddy nuzzled Riahc's arm, and Riahc smiled at him and murmered some soothing words. Concern began to flow into the bond, reminding Riahc that Aniram could sense his feelings just as well as he could hers.

The beginning. That’s what she had told Riahc- her Warder. She had to get used to calling him that. Aniram was convinced that the Darkfriends were hunting him, after all they had almost killed him that night she met him face to face for the first time.

Loss and hurt flooded through the bond. It was so strong that Aniram had to blink back tears of her own. What happened to Riahc to make his hurt so strong? I must find out, I must, Aniram thought. Riding silently for a few steps, she thought about how to get Riahc to open up. She decided on inquiring boldly; no Aes Sedai word tricks would crack this man. “Tell me what happened in Four Kings. I need to know,” it was more of a command then than a question.

Aniram felt her Warder’s emotions sink in her mind like a rock in water, full of suspicion, loss, hate, and stubbornness. Outwardly she was met with stone cold silence. Aniram sighed. Braking Riahc would be more work than she thought.

The pair spent the rest of the daylight hours riding, then walking for a mile or so (so as not to tire out the horses completely), then riding again, Riahc silent as the dust on the road, and Aniram contemplating ways to get him speaking again. She was so absorbed in thought that she didn’t notice twilight rapidly blotting out the sun, still no Four Kings in sight.

“We must stop to make camp,” Riahc’s quiet whisper shattered the long held silence. Aniram jumped at the sound. Look at me, acting like a Brown, so out of this world that my own Warder’s voice shocks me! She grumbled inwardly. She managed to get out a ‘yes, here’s fine’ between mumbling and moaning as her stiff muscles moved.

Riahc led them off into the trees to the west of the Caemlyn Road and stopped in a clearing by the river. Aniram sat herself down with a grunt while Riahc busied himself by collecting firewood, building a fire, cutting boughs for rough beds and other such things.

After a small meal of dry bread and hard cheese that left her stomach growling, Aniram decided she would try again, “You must tell me of your past, you must. It will surely help us figure out what the Darkfriends are after. It will actually tell us many thing, all of which may be important. I can assure you that I will sympathize with your experiences; we are bonded. If you will not tell me to solve the Darkfriend mystery, then you must tell me for the sake of our bond. It is your duty as Warder to Aes Sedai to-“

“You need to stretch,” Riahc’s softly spoken word cut off Aniram’s voice, her carefully thought out speech falling into a frivolous pantomime. “I can tell your muscles are cramping and causing you discomfiture. Here, do this, it’ll make you feel better,” Riahc stood on one foot while holding the other bent behind him as he was speaking.

Aniram closed her gaping mouth with an audible click and promptly turned her back on her posing Warder. He cut me off! How disrespectful! And now he’s trying to boss me around! Who does he think he is? I am the Aes Sedai here, not this, this- youngling! Aniram stiffly stoked over to her saddle bags, grabbed the course wool blanket, limped to the pile of boughs that would serve as a bed and lay down. She closed her eyes and tried to ignore the pulsing of lead and fire in her legs. It was well after dark when the Aes Sedai finally fell asleep.

Riahc sat on a fallen tree, tending the small fire he had built. He watched where Aniram lay on a rough bed of boughs, breathing deep in sleep. Riahc contemplated when and how he should tell Aniram of his past. He knew he would have to tell her sooner or later, whether he told her willingly or not. He decided he would tell her today, before they left camp. Riahc put the last log on the fire and stretched out on his own pile of boughs. Sleep came within moments of laying his head down.

Riahc awoke the next morning before the sun. He began saddling and bridling the horses, so when Aniram awoke they could continue travelling wasting little time. Aniram sighed and opened her eyes. Soreness gushed through the bond. Aniram should have stretched last night, as he had told her to, and was paying for it this morning.

“Good morning,” Riahc said. “Did you rest well?” Aniram just nodded in Riahc’s direction as she dug through her saddle bags. She took out an ivory comb and began pulling it through her glossy dark locks. Riahc felt at his own hair curling out at the nape of his neck and behind his ears. Riahc had never been too concerned about his appearance and wondered whether being bonded as Aniram’s Warder would change things.

Riahc was trying to find the right time to enlighten Aniram about his family, but decided there would never be a ‘right’ time.

“I’m sorry for not answering you yesterday. About what happened in Four Kings.” Riahc said bluntly. Aniram nodded and began to say something, but Riahc cut her off. “As you know, I was born there, and I lived with my father, mother and sister. We lived in a small house, just outside the town. We had a large fruit bearing tree that my sister and I would climb and play on.” Riahc smiled at the recollection of his home and family, but his face darkened as he continued. “On a normal day, about this time of year, darkfriends attacked us. They killed my father, mother, and sister. I was the only one who got away. My father tried so hard to protect them. But… it just wasn’t enough.” Riahc pushed down his emptiness and hurt and continued. “I just perched in the tree, and watched. I’ll never forgive myself for not doing more. So I left. I bought myself a horse and I rode north, and kept riding north, until I found myself walking the streets of Tar Valon. And then, you know the rest,” Riahc finished.

Aniram walked up to Riahc and touched him on the cheek. "I'm sorry," was all she said. With a sigh, she turned and began to ready her saddle bags for the long journey still ahead of them.
